/* Written by Simon Josefsson.  */

#include <config.h>

#include "hmac.h"

#include "memxor.h"
#include "md5.h"

#include <string.h>

#define IPAD 0x36
#define OPAD 0x5c

int
hmac_md5 (const void *key, size_t keylen,
	  const void *in, size_t inlen, void *resbuf)
{
  struct md5_ctx inner;
  struct md5_ctx outer;
  char optkeybuf[16];
  char block[64];
  char innerhash[16];

  /* Reduce the key's size, so that it becomes <= 64 bytes large.  */

  if (keylen > 64)
    {
      struct md5_ctx keyhash;

      md5_init_ctx (&keyhash);
      md5_process_bytes (key, keylen, &keyhash);
      md5_finish_ctx (&keyhash, optkeybuf);

      key = optkeybuf;
      keylen = 16;
    }

  /* Compute INNERHASH from KEY and IN.  */

  md5_init_ctx (&inner);

  memset (block, IPAD, sizeof (block));
  memxor (block, key, keylen);

  md5_process_block (block, 64, &inner);
  md5_process_bytes (in, inlen, &inner);

  md5_finish_ctx (&inner, innerhash);

  /* Compute result from KEY and INNERHASH.  */

  md5_init_ctx (&outer);

  memset (block, OPAD, sizeof (block));
  memxor (block, key, keylen);

  md5_process_block (block, 64, &outer);
  md5_process_bytes (innerhash, 16, &outer);

  md5_finish_ctx (&outer, resbuf);

  return 0;
}
